The Basics of Real Life Insurance

Understanding the Concept

Real life insurance, also known as permanent life insurance, is a crucial financial instrument that offers long-term protection and savings benefits. Unlike term life insurance, which provides coverage for a specific period, real life insurance guarantees a payout to your beneficiaries upon your demise, regardless of when it occurs.

With real life insurance, you can rest assured that your loved ones will be safeguarded even after you’re gone. Additionally, the policy accumulates a cash value over time, which can be accessed during your lifetime, providing financial stability for various purposes.

Types of Real Life Insurance Policies

When it comes to real life insurance, there are several options available to suit your unique needs and circumstances. Let’s explore two widely popular types:

Whole Life Insurance

Whole life insurance offers lifelong protection, guaranteed death benefits, and a cash value component that grows over time. This type of policy provides stability and predictability, making it an excellent choice for those seeking long-term financial security.

Universal Life Insurance

Universal life insurance empowers individuals with flexibility, allowing them to adjust their coverage and premiums as their circumstances change. This type of policy offers lifelong protection, death benefits, and the potential to accumulate cash value.

Unveiling the Benefits of Real Life Insurance

1. Lifelong Protection

One of the key advantages of real life insurance is the lifelong protection it offers. Unlike term life insurance, which may only cover you for a specific period, real life insurance ensures your loved ones are protected until the end of your days.

As we navigate through life, responsibilities change, and loved ones grow older. By securing a real life insurance policy, you can rest assured that your family will receive the financial support they need, regardless of when the inevitable occurs.

2. Cash Value Accumulation

Another significant benefit of real life insurance is the cash value component. Over time, as you diligently pay your premiums, a portion of it goes into a cash value account that grows tax-deferred. This accumulated cash value can serve as a valuable asset, allowing you to borrow against it or even surrender the policy for a lump sum if needed.

Think of it as a financial safety net that helps you achieve future goals such as financing education, purchasing a home, or supplementing your retirement income.

3. Tax Advantages

Real life insurance can bring some tax advantages to the table. The growth of the cash value is tax-deferred, meaning you won’t owe taxes on the accrued interest and investment gains until you withdraw the funds. Additionally, these policies often include a tax-free death benefit, ensuring that your beneficiaries receive the payout without any tax burdens.

It’s crucial to consult with a tax professional or financial advisor to fully understand the tax implications of your specific policy.

Frequently Asked Questions about Real Life Insurance

1. What is real life insurance?

Real life insurance, also known as permanent life insurance, provides lifelong protection and a cash value component that grows over time.

2. How is real life insurance different from term life insurance?

Real life insurance covers you for your entire life, whereas term life insurance offers coverage for a specific period.

3. Can I access the cash value of my real life insurance policy?

Yes, you can borrow against the cash value or surrender your policy for a lump sum, providing financial flexibility.

4. Is the cash value of a real life insurance policy taxable?

The growth of the cash value is tax-deferred, meaning you won’t owe taxes until you withdraw the funds.

5. Can I adjust my coverage and premiums with real life insurance?

Universal life insurance allows policyholders to adjust their coverage and premiums as their circumstances change.

6. How does real life insurance benefit estate planning?

A real life insurance policy’s death benefit can provide liquidity to cover estate taxes and ensure a smoother transfer of wealth.

7. Is real life insurance necessary if I already have savings and investments?

Real life insurance can complement your savings and investments by providing an added layer of financial security for your loved ones.

8. Can I have more than one real life insurance policy?

Yes, you can have multiple real life insurance policies to tailor your coverage to your specific needs and goals.

9. Can I convert my term life insurance policy into a real life insurance policy?

In many cases, term life insurance policies offer the option to convert to real life insurance policies, providing continued coverage and cash value accumulation.

10. How do I choose the right real life insurance policy?

Choosing the right real life insurance policy depends on various factors, such as your financial goals, budget, and risk tolerance. Consulting with a reputable insurance agent or financial advisor can help guide you towards the best choice.
